Welcome to Minute Mondays, where we kickstart your week in under five minutes. Today's wisdom comes from Theodore Roosevelt: "In any moment of decision, the best thing you can do is the right thing, the next best thing is the wrong thing, and the worst thing you can do is nothing." As you navigate decisions, stay grounded, reflect on outcomes, and avoid stagnation. Whether moving forward effortlessly or learning lessons, never regress. Share insights with others to reinforce your commitment to living these principles. 

Remember, action is key, and intentional reflection beats stagnation. Crush your week with this advice from Theodore Roosevelt.
